K - type for map keyV - type for map valuepublic class DefaultConsistentMapBuilder<K,V> extends ConsistentMapBuilder<K,V>
AsyncConsistentMap builder.| Constructor and Description |
|---|
DefaultConsistentMapBuilder(DistributedPrimitiveCreator primitiveCreator) |
| Modifier and Type | Method and Description |
|---|---|
ConsistentMap<K,V> |
build()
Constructs an instance of the distributed primitive.
|
AsyncConsistentMap<K,V> |
buildAsyncMap()
Builds an async consistent map based on the configuration options
supplied to this builder.
|
purgeOnUninstall, withPurgeOnUninstallapplicationId, executorSupplier, meteringEnabled, name, partitionsDisabled, readOnly, relaxedReadConsistency, serializer, type, withApplicationId, withExecutor, withExecutorSupplier, withMeteringDisabled, withName, withRelaxedReadConsistency, withSerializer, withUpdatesDisabledpublic DefaultConsistentMapBuilder(DistributedPrimitiveCreator primitiveCreator)
public ConsistentMap<K,V> build()
DistributedPrimitiveBuilderbuild in class DistributedPrimitiveBuilder<ConsistentMapBuilder<K,V>,ConsistentMap<K,V>>public AsyncConsistentMap<K,V> buildAsyncMap()
ConsistentMapBuilderbuildAsyncMap in class ConsistentMapBuilder<K,V>